<html><head><meta http-equiv="Content-Type" content="text/html charset=us-ascii"></head><body style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space;"><br><div><div>On May 8, 2014, at 2:42 PM, Brandon Allbery &lt;<a href="mailto:allbery.b@gmail.com">allbery.b@gmail.com</a>&gt; wrote:</div><br class="Apple-interchange-newline"><blockquote type="cite"><div dir="ltr"><div class="gmail_extra"><div class="gmail_quote">On Thu, May 8, 2014 at 5:35 PM, Jerry <span dir="ltr">&lt;<a href="mailto:lanceboyle@qwest.net" target="_blank">lanceboyle@qwest.net</a>&gt;</span> w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">I just upgraded my OS to 10.9 from 10.8 and am following the instructions for migrating MacPorts at <a href="https://trac.macports.org/wiki/Migration" target="_blank">https://trac.macports.org/wiki/Migration</a>.<br>

<br>
I am considering using the "Automatically reinstall ports" suggestion whereby a script is downloaded which script then works with a previously saved myports.txt. If I do this, will the script install old versions of ports which had not been active? I'm thinking that this might be a good time to do some decrufting and I would like to consider these old inactive versions as mostly cruft and not reinstall them.<br>
</blockquote><div><br></div><div>I make a list of active and requested ports (port echo active and requested) and just reinstall those; it'll pull in what it needs automatically, and because I do it that way I keep the requested flags.</div></div></div></div></blockquote><div><br></div>Thanks, Brandon.<br><div><br></div>I redirected this output to .txt files. Do you have a quick way (script) to use these echoed files during reinstallation?<br><blockquote type="cite"><div dir="ltr"><div class="gmail_extra"><div class="gmail_quote">
<div>&nbsp;</div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
Also, I've been confused about binary versions--are there binary versions of some ports and if so I would like to install them preferentially over building from source. How do I discover the presence of a binary port and how do I install it?<br>
</blockquote></div><div class="gmail_extra"><br></div>That happens by default, assuming you have not changed /opt/local/etc/macports/macports.conf; you may want to review yours against /opt/local/etc/macports/macports.conf.default to see what additions or changes may be there. A port will be installed from a binary archive if (a) we have a buildbot for it [so for example not for Leopard/10.5], (b) the license is compatible with binary distribution, and (c) you are using default variants.<br clear="all"></div></div></blockquote><div><br></div>I ran these through FileMerge which indicated 30 differences. But all the differences were in comments (and they were very large differences). But all of the "working" lines are the same.</div><div><br></div><div>FWIW,&nbsp;macports.conf.default has a creation and modification date of October 25, 2013, while&nbsp;macports.conf has both dates April 2, 2012. Note that at this stage I have run the .pkg installer according to&nbsp;<a href="https://trac.macports.org/wiki/Migration">https://trac.macports.org/wiki/Migration</a> and links therefrom.</div><div><br><blockquote type="cite"><div dir="ltr"><div class="gmail_extra">
<div><br></div>-- <br><div dir="ltr"><div>brandon s allbery kf8nh &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; sine nomine associates</div><div><a href="mailto:allbery.b@gmail.com" target="_blank">allbery.b@gmail.com</a> &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p;<a href="mailto:ballbery@sinenomine.net" target="_blank">ballbery@sinenomine.net</a></div>
<div>unix, openafs, kerberos, infrastructure, xmonad &nbsp; &nbsp; &nbsp; &nbsp;<a href="http://sinenomine.net/" target="_blank">http://sinenomine.net</a></div></div>
</div></div>
</blockquote></div><br></body></html>